: 区块链钱包地址的数量究竟有多少?

引言

随着区块链技术的快速发展,虚拟货币的普及越来越广泛,很多人开始关注区块链钱包这一重要组成部分。区块链钱包用于存储和管理数字资产,作为用户与区块链之间的桥梁,它的地址数量以及特点,对于用户而言尤为重要。在这篇文章中,我们将详细探讨区块链钱包地址的数量以及与其相关的一些问题。

区块链钱包地址的定义与功能

首先,我们需要明确什么是区块链钱包地址。简单来说,区块链钱包地址是一个字符串,通常由字母和数字组成,用于标识一个用户的数字资产的存储位置。每个钱包地址都是唯一的,这意味着您可以通过该地址接收和发送数字资产。

此外,钱包地址的生成是基于公钥密码学的方法,用户在创建钱包时通常会生成一对密钥:公钥和私钥。公钥用于生成钱包地址,而私钥则用于对交易进行签名,确保资产的安全存储。

区块链钱包地址的数量是多少?

区块链钱包地址的数量是一个复杂的问题。在理论上,许多区块链协议如比特币等使用了256位的地址生成算法,这意味着潜在的地址数量为2的256次方,即大约为1.1579209 × 10^77个地址。这个数量是如此之大,几乎不可能被耗尽。

然而,在实际应用中,可能创建的有效地址数量会受到各种因素的限制,比如地址的使用以及私钥的管理。如果某个地址的私钥丢失,那么该地址中的资产将永远无法使用。这使得即使地址数量庞大,实际上可用的地址数仍然有限。

潜在的地址使用情况

在使用过程中,不同用户会根据需要创建多个钱包地址。例如,一个用户可能会为不同的交易或者活动使用不同的地址,以确保隐私和安全。这种做法使得监控和追踪特定用户的交易变得困难。

此外,用户在使用虚拟货币时可能会使用多个平台,比如交易所、个人钱包和硬件钱包。每个平台通常会生成不同的地址供用户使用。这样的情况加大了地址的消耗,使得每个用户独立管理的钱包地址数量并非理想状态。

地址数量与安全性的关系

地址数量的庞大为用户提供了某种程度的安全保障。当用户创建多个钱包地址并分散持有资产时,单一地址的潜在被攻击风险会被分散,从而提高了整体安全性。然而,这并不意味着用户可以放松对钱包地址和私钥的管理,用户仍需确保其私钥的安全存放,避免因丢失私钥而无法访问资金。

随着越来越多的人加入区块链领域,安全问题变得尤为重要。用户应该了解如何安全地生成和管理钱包地址,使用良好的安全实践来保护自己的资产。例如,建议用户定期对其资产进行安全审查,使用硬件钱包来存储大额资产,避免在网络上使用热钱包。

相关问题解析

1. 区块链钱包地址怎么生成?

区块链钱包地址的生成过程基于公钥密码学,主要分为生成密钥对和生成地址两个步骤。首先,用户需要使用加密算法生成一对密钥:公钥和私钥。私钥是一个随机生成的256位数字,用户应该确保其私钥绝对保密,而公钥则可以公开。

在生成完密钥对后,公钥会进一步经过哈希运算,并应用一定的算法生成钱包地址。对于比特币钱包地址来说,生成的过程一般是先对公钥使用SHA-256哈希函数,然后再用RIPEMD-160哈希算法得到最终的地址。

这样的地址生成机制确保了每个地址都是唯一且安全的。如果需要创建新的钱包地址,用户可以简单地重复上述过程,而不需要担心会产生冲突或重复的地址,这就是为什么理论上的地址数量是如此巨大。

2. 如何安全地管理区块链钱包地址?

管理区块链钱包地址的安全性是一项重要的任务,尤其是随着越来越多的虚拟资产被盗事件的发生。安全管理钱包地址的几个基本原则包括:首先,使用硬件钱包存储大额资产,因为硬件钱包比软件钱包安全得多。其次,务必备份钱包私钥,如果丢失,用户将无法访问其资产。

同时,避免在公共网络环境中进行资产管理,尤其是在使用热钱包时,确保网络连接是安全的。此外,不要随意点击不明链接或下载不明软件,以防止恶意软件对私钥的窃取。

最后,定期审查您的个人安全措施,如果有可疑活动发生,尽快更换钱包地址并移动资产。通过采取这些措施,您可以大幅降低资产丢失的风险。

3. 区块链钱包地址可以重复使用吗?

重复使用区块链钱包地址是一个相对复杂的问题。理论上,用户可以重复使用相同的钱包地址进行多个交易,但从安全和隐私的角度来看,这种做法并不推荐。每次在同一地址上接收或发送资产都会将该地址的交易历史暴露给所有人,可能造成用户隐私泄露。

为了提高安全性和隐私,许多用户选择采用“新地址”策略,即每次交易时生成一个新的接收地址。很多现代钱包都有这一自动生成新地址的功能,用户只需接收资产时选择即可。这不仅能保护隐私,还能降低资产被追踪的风险。

4. 大量地址会影响区块链网络吗?

虽然区块链的设计初衷是为了解决去中心化问题,但是大量地址的生成与使用仍然对区块链网络产生一定影响。首先,生成和管理大量的地址需要额外的存储空间和资源,尤其是在最初的区块链阶段,存储限制可能会显得更加明显。

在网络运行的过程中,大量地址可能会导致链上的交易历史记录急剧增长,从而使节点加载交易数据的时间增加,影响网络的整体性能。但大多数现代区块链设计都已考虑到这样的问题,通过分片技术、侧链等方式来减轻网络负担,从而实现高效运行。

5. 区块链钱包地址是否可以转让给他人?

区块链钱包地址属于用户的数字资产,虽然它本身是一个公开的标识符,但用户可以选择将其私钥管理权转让给他人。具体来说,如果某人希望将其钱包中的资产转让给另一人,他们可以提供该地址的私钥,以便对方能够控制该地址内的资产。需要提醒的是,这种做法是非常不安全的,因为私钥一旦公开,任何人都可以访问和盗用地址内的资产。

更安全的做法是将资产转移到另一个地址,而不是仅仅转让控制权。通过从原地址发送资产至新地址,用户可以确保自己的安全性和资产的完整性。

总结

总之,区块链钱包地址的数量庞大且几乎不可能被耗尽,然而在实际应用中,用户需关注如何管理和使用这些地址。考虑到安全性和隐私,用户应当提出合理策略,保护自己的资产不受侵害。希望通过本文的详细解析,您对区块链钱包地址有了更深入的了解,并能够更好地利用这一工具。